#b4eada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4eada is composed of 70.6% red, 91.8%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.8%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 162.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 81.2%. #b4eada color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#69d5b5.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

● #b4eada color description : Very soft cyan - lime green.
#b4eada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4eada has RGB values of R:180, G:234,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 11856602.

Shades and Tints of #b4eada
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#f1fb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b4eada
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ced0cf is the less saturated color, while #a2fce2 is the most saturated one.
